Climate & Weather in Orange, NSW
Orange, NSW has a temperate oceanic climate (Köppen Cfb) with warm to mild summers and cold winters. Its high elevation gives it cool mornings, frequent winter frosts, and moderate rainfall spread through the year, making it much cooler than much of inland Australia.

Spring
September - November
14-22°C
Spring is cool to mild and becomes progressively warmer through the season, with variable weather and occasional rainfall. Days are often pleasant, while mornings can still be chilly.

Summer
December - February
16-27°C
Summer is warm but not extreme compared with much of inland Australia, with cool nights and occasional hot days. Rainfall occurs periodically, but long dry sunny spells are also common.

Autumn
March - May
10-21°C
Autumn is one of the most comfortable periods in Orange, with warm early days that steadily cool toward late May. Rainfall is fairly even, and crisp evenings become more frequent.

Winter
June - August
1-12°C
Winter is cold, with frequent frosts and some mornings near or below freezing. Rain can occur through the season, and the highest elevations around Orange can occasionally see snow.
